Planning Your Visit

Conquer the Cliffs: Be Prepared for the Climb

Tintagel Castle involves steep paths and uneven terrain. Comfortable, sturdy shoes are a must! Consider the shuttle bus if the climb back up is a concern, especially for those with mobility issues or after a long day of exploring. Reddit

Book Ahead & Time Your Visit

While tickets can be bought on the day, booking online is recommended, especially during peak season, to avoid queues. Reddit Late morning offers the best light for photography and can be less crowded than midday. Reddit

"Really worth a visit, especially on a perfect day, like today! Stunning views. The new bridge is quite remarkable, and very well stabilised. Very busy but it was nice to see so many overseas visitors. The English Heritage run café there is great, with large pasties in evidence and good coffee and cakes.
Tasteful gift shop including an informative exhibition, and with public loos for a wash and brush up. Also an electric shuttle bus to take us elderly tourists back up the very steep hill to Tintagel. Ice cream from a mobile van was very welcome too. Allow 2 plus hours to take it all in. Late morning is best light for photography."

"Parked in the big car park opposite the old post office. Good rates to stay.
Booked tickets on line for Castle had a set entry time.
Path to Castle is steep going down and steps going up to the entrance point.
Once past this point walkway is marked , wear sturdy footwear, views are amazing, allow your imagination to drift back in time to how the castle looked, how hard it must have been to live there. Plus the amazing statue to see.
Cafe and gift shop lies in the valley below, steps going down steep at times. View of bridge and sea is great from here. Cafe is well stocked.
Electric mini bus can take you most of the way back up the valley for £2 donation per adult and 50p for dog.
Loved our visit, staff helpful and friendly."

🚇 🗺️ Getting There

Tintagel Castle is located on the North Cornwall coast. If driving, there are car parks nearby, though they can fill up quickly. TikTok Public transport options include buses that run to Tintagel village. From the village, it's a walk to the castle entrance. Reddit

🎫 🎫 Tickets & Entry

Tintagel Castle is managed by English Heritage. Members get free entry. For non-members, ticket prices vary, and booking online in advance is recommended. Instagram
